How much does a Legacy Applications Programmer - Senior make in Texas? The average Legacy Applications Programmer - Senior salary in Texas is $98,100 as of May 28, 2024, but the range typically falls between $88,400 and $111,800.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on the city and many other important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ession.

Job Description

The Legacy Applications Programmer - Senior maintains and develops online and batch application programs. Reviews, analyzes, and modifies programming systems including encoding, testing, debugging and installing for a large-scale mainframe computer system. Being a Legacy Applications Programmer - Senior works with project members to develop specifications, diagrams and flowcharts. Develops and implements a disaster recovery plan. In addition, Legacy Applications Programmer - Senior may require a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a project leader or manager. Being a Legacy Applications Programmer - Senior contributes to moderately complex aspects of a project. Work is generally independent and collaborative in nature. Working as a Legacy Applications Programmer - Senior typically requires 4 to 7 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)
